Understanding Mirror Sites in Online Gaming
Mirror sites are alternative versions of a primary website that are hosted on different servers at different locations. They are primarily designed to provide users with unrestricted access to a platform, especially in regions where the primary site may be blocked or facing issues due to heavy traffic. The idea is to create an identical experience, allowing users to enjoy their favorite games without interruption. The Role of Mirror Sites in Gaming
The concept of mirror sites is particularly relevant to online gaming for several reasons:
- Accessibility: Mirror sites guarantee that players can access the game regardless of their geographical location or any prevailing internet restrictions.
- Load Balancing: By distributing the traffic across multiple servers, mirror sites can help alleviate server overload and improve game performance, especially during peak hours.
- Enhanced Security: Mirror sites can provide an added layer of security, protecting user data and minimizing the risk of downtime due to attacks on the main site.
